google-cloud-sql - mysql 客户端连接 gcloud

标签 google-cloud-sql gcloud

我已经安装了 gcloud 客户端库,但 GCP 一直给我这个错误是什么问题

错误:(gcloud.sql.connect) 找不到 Mysql 客户端。请安装一个 mysql 客户端并确保它在 PATH 中以便能够连接到数据库实例

最佳答案

问题是你本地没有安装MySQL客户端,或者gcloud找不到。

如果您还没有安装 MySQL,follow the instructions这样做。

如果您已经安装了 MySQL 但仍然出现此错误,请尝试输入 mysql在 shell 提示符下。如果您收到 command not found错误,您的 $PATH 中缺少 MySQL,您需要弄清楚它的安装位置。

例如,在 OS X 上,MySQL 默认为 /usr/local/mysql/bin/ .将此添加到您的 $PATH,它应该开始工作:

export PATH=$PATH:/usr/local/mysql/bin/

关于google-cloud-sql - mysql 客户端连接 gcloud,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/44429326/

相关文章:

maven - 从 jar 文件调用 Dataflow 进程,出现错误 PipelineOptions 缺少名为 'gcpTempLocation' 的属性

java - Google APP Engine 和 cloud sql::无法在 Google cloud sql 中连接 Spring boot 应用程序(我的 sql)

kubernetes - HPA无法读取GKE上的指标值(CPU利用率)

google-cloud-platform - 将 VPC 连接到 Cloud SQL

mysql - 将 linux 命令的输出导入 MySQL 表

google-bigquery - 如何让 gcloud auth activate-service-account 持久化

docker - 构建gcloud项目时出现问题:复制失败:未指定任何源文件

docker - 是否可以在 boot2docker 上安装 gcloud(谷歌云 sdk)?

具有两个父项的 MySQL 表 - 在行删除期间,删除不会级联 - Google Cloud SQL

mysql - 将 Spring Boot 应用程序连接到 Google Cloud 中的 MySQL 数据库